--- pageClass: is-wide-page --- # LedControl (UORB message) LED control: control a single or multiple LED's. These are the externally visible LED's, not the board LED's. **TOPICS:** led_control ## Fields | Name | Type | Unit [Frame] | Range/Enum | Description | | ---------- | -------- | ------------ | ---------- | --------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------- | | timestamp | `uint64` | | | time since system start (microseconds) | | led_mask | `uint8` | | | bitmask which LED(s) to control, set to 0xff for all | | color | `uint8` | | | see COLOR\_\* | | mode | `uint8` | | | see MODE\_\* | | num_blinks | `uint8` | | | how many times to blink (number of on-off cycles if mode is one of MODE*BLINK*\*) . Set to 0 for infinite | | priority | `uint8` | | | priority: higher priority events will override current lower priority events (see MAX_PRIORITY) | ## Constants | Name | Type | Value | Description | | ------------------------------------------------- | ------- | ----- | --------------------------------------------------------------------------------------- | | COLOR_OFF | `uint8` | 0 | this is only used in the drivers | | COLOR_RED | `uint8` | 1 | | COLOR_GREEN | `uint8` | 2 | | COLOR_BLUE | `uint8` | 3 | | COLOR_YELLOW | `uint8` | 4 | | COLOR_PURPLE | `uint8` | 5 | | COLOR_AMBER | `uint8` | 6 | | COLOR_CYAN | `uint8` | 7 | | COLOR_WHITE | `uint8` | 8 | | MODE_OFF | `uint8` | 0 | turn LED off | | MODE_ON | `uint8` | 1 | turn LED on | | MODE_DISABLED | `uint8` | 2 | disable this priority (switch to lower priority setting) | | MODE_BLINK_SLOW | `uint8` | 3 | | MODE_BLINK_NORMAL | `uint8` | 4 | | MODE_BLINK_FAST | `uint8` | 5 | | MODE_BREATHE | `uint8` | 6 | continuously increase & decrease brightness (solid color if driver does not support it) | | MODE_FLASH | `uint8` | 7 | two fast blinks (on/off) with timing as in MODE_BLINK_FAST and then off for a while | | MAX_PRIORITY | `uint8` | 2 | maximum priority (minimum is 0) | | ORB_QUEUE_LENGTH | `uint8` | 8 | needs to match BOARD_MAX_LEDS | ## Source Message [Source file (GitHub)](https://github.com/PX4/PX4-Autopilot/blob/main/msg/LedControl.msg) ::: details Click here to see original file ```c # LED control: control a single or multiple LED's. # These are the externally visible LED's, not the board LED's uint64 timestamp # time since system start (microseconds) # colors uint8 COLOR_OFF = 0 # this is only used in the drivers uint8 COLOR_RED = 1 uint8 COLOR_GREEN = 2 uint8 COLOR_BLUE = 3 uint8 COLOR_YELLOW = 4 uint8 COLOR_PURPLE = 5 uint8 COLOR_AMBER = 6 uint8 COLOR_CYAN = 7 uint8 COLOR_WHITE = 8 # LED modes definitions uint8 MODE_OFF = 0 # turn LED off uint8 MODE_ON = 1 # turn LED on uint8 MODE_DISABLED = 2 # disable this priority (switch to lower priority setting) uint8 MODE_BLINK_SLOW = 3 uint8 MODE_BLINK_NORMAL = 4 uint8 MODE_BLINK_FAST = 5 uint8 MODE_BREATHE = 6 # continuously increase & decrease brightness (solid color if driver does not support it) uint8 MODE_FLASH = 7 # two fast blinks (on/off) with timing as in MODE_BLINK_FAST and then off for a while uint8 MAX_PRIORITY = 2 # maximum priority (minimum is 0) uint8 led_mask # bitmask which LED(s) to control, set to 0xff for all uint8 color # see COLOR_* uint8 mode # see MODE_* uint8 num_blinks # how many times to blink (number of on-off cycles if mode is one of MODE_BLINK_*) .
